1. London Docklands Redevelopment
2. What was it like ? In the 19th Century one of the busiest ports in the world it was flourishing !
By the 1950s most Docks had closed they were too small for the new size of tankers/ships
3. Conditions in the 1950s Unemployment no longer need dockers
Associated industry also goes shipbuilders, repairers, chandlers, warehouses etc etc etc
Poor quality housing sub standard
Lots of derelict land (over 50%)
Very poor transport links
Virtually no open space
4. London Docklands Development Corporation This was set up to solve the Docklands problem. It had 3 aims
1. Create jobs & improve transport to make it more prosperous
2. Improve the environment by restoring derelict land, cleaning up & creating open space
3. To improve houses & local amenities

6. How has this helped the locals ? Most of jobs were high tec and did not go to locals
Much of the new housing was far too expensive for the locals
More money has been generated the place is better off
But prices have risen due to the new wealth its more expensive to live there
7. New comers (rich) and locals (poor) rarely mix
Transport has been improved DLR (railway) and City Airport
The area has been tidied up & open space created
Some low cost houses have been built
Much of money spent on expensive office blocks etc not hospitals, schools etc
